Police and highways personnel were called out to a small Somerset village in the early hours of this morning after a lorry collided with a wall.

Officers from Avon and Somerset Constabulary were called out to Broad Street in Charlton Adam near Somerton just after 2.30am.A lorry had collided with a wall, blocking the road for more than three-and-a-half hours.A police spokesman said: “We were called at 2.35am to reports that a lorry had collided with a wall.
